About this album
On this album, Menomena reveal a unique vision of inventive, melodic, and ambient-warped-pop, lifting off from the same experimental runway as the Brian Eno and David Byrne era guitar-electronica-collaboration. It was produced, mixed and recorded by the band.
This debut album was self-released by the band on May 20, 2003. It was later re-released in 2004 by Portland-based independent record label FILMguerrero
The title is an anagram for “The First Menomena Album.”
